False alarm of people stuck in elevator reportedRochester NY

audio iconFire & Arson
Near N Clinton Ave, Rochester, NY 14604

Fire crews responded to a report of three people stuck in elevator number two on the first floor at the Michael Stern building near North Clinton Avenue. After checking the building and contacting the monitoring company, no occupants were found trapped. The call was determined to be a false alarm.
